dc.description.abstractThis study demonstrates a second generation version of a three-level injection seeded Er:glass laser that works as a transform limited coherent laser radar. This laser is designed to maximize the average power that can be extracted from a bulk glass host. It uses pulsed pump diode lasers and a conduction cooled, co-planar folded zig-zag slab (CPFS) gain medium in an injection seeded, long Q switched pulsed configuration. This laser can operate at 60 mJ per pulse at 10 Hz in a standing wave configuration. For eye-safe operation it should not exceed 10 mJ per pulse. The resonator used in this work is developed specifically for generating long pulse, single frequency Q-switched outputs in low gain laser media. This work describes the latest results of this prototype laser and its properties for coherent single frequency sensing. A design for a third generation of this laser are also be discussed
